WebAs a young girl, Yewa was abandoned by her parents and went to live in a cave. When she was discovered, Olofi (another name for God) took her out of her cave and blessed her. When she grew old, she returned to the cave, and there met Death. She is the true owner of the cemtary, as she owns the bones in the ground. Attempts to regain contact with their God by … Web11 aug. 2024 · How many orisha gods are there? Different oral traditions refer to 400, 700, or 1,440 orishas. Yoruba tradition frequently says that there are 400 1 orishas, which is associated with a sacred number. Other sources suggest that the number is as many as you can think of, plus one more – an innumerable number. Who is the orisha of death?
